The Myth of Passive Core Engagement
Traditional ab workouts often lean on repetitive crunches and leg raises—movements that isolate the rectus abdominis while neglecting the deeper stabilizers. This creates a misleading illusion of strength. In reality, functional ab strength requires co-contraction of the transverse abdominis, obliques, and pelvic floor, all under variable load and dynamic control. Kettlebells disrupt this myth by introducing instability—requiring the body to constantly adapt. A single 16kg kettlebell, when swung diagonally or held static in a lunge, forces the core to engage not just as a flexor, but as a cross-sectional stabilizer.
This subtle shift—from isolated contraction to integrated stability—mimics real-life demands: catching a fall, twisting to throw a ball, or even turning to avoid a collision. The kettlebell doesn’t just train the abdominals; it trains the nervous system to recruit muscle synergies efficiently. It’s not about endurance or hypertrophy alone—it’s about reactive strength and neuromuscular coordination.
Beyond the Swing: Precision Loading in Ab Training
Modern kettlebell ab programming moves past brute force. Think of the “Windmill” or “Double Windmill” variations—movements that combine rotational power with core bracing. These aren’t just flashy; they’re biomechanically advanced. In a windmill, the torso rotates under load while the lower body stabilizes, forcing the obliques and transverse abdominis to fire in sequence. The kettlebell’s weight trains the body to maintain spinal integrity despite rotational torque—a hallmark of true functional strength.
Even static holds, like holding a kettlebell in a squat or lunge position, demand continuous core engagement. This challenges not just muscle endurance but also proprioception. The body learns to adjust in real time—fine-tuning balance with minimal visual feedback. This mirrors athletic demands where split-second corrections prevent injury and improve performance. It’s the difference between training the core as a muscle and training it as a neuromuscular system.
Risks and Realism: When Functionality Meets Fragility
Not every kettlebell ab workout is created equal. The same tool that builds resilience can breed recklessness. Improper form—especially rounding the spine under load—can strain the lumbar region. A 2022 incident in a high-profile fitness competition underscored this: a competitor’s drop landing, caused by weak oblique control during a windmill, resulted in a severe lower back injury. This isn’t a failure of the kettlebell, but a warning: functional strength demands technical mastery, not just volume or weight.
Coaches now emphasize progression: start with controlled, low-load movements to build neuromuscular awareness. The goal isn’t to hoist heavy weights, but to teach the body to stabilize, rotate, and transfer force efficiently. It’s a return to first principles—training the body as it moves, not just in isolation.
